← all jobs

Frontend Engineer (React / Next.js)

Work from home Full-time role Hiring

Salmon is a next-generation fintech company with a clear mission: to reshape the banking landscape in the Philippines and demonstrate that people deserve better financial services. Founded by visionary leaders Pavel Fedorov, George Chesakov, and Raffy Montemayor, Salmon is more than just a fast-growing technology company – we’re a bank with over 60 years of heritage. In 2024, we proudly transformed the Rural Bank of Sta. Rosa (Laguna), Inc. into Salmon Bank (Rural Bank) Inc. With over 1 million Filipinos already trusting Salmon, we are continuously expanding our offerings and aiming to become a true financial super app for millions more. Why Salmon? Exponential Growth: In 2025, we more than doubled our deposits, loans, and net income. Loved by Users: Our app is rated 4.8★, with 92% of users recommending us to friends and family. Top-Tier Team: Work alongside experts from fintech, banking, startups, and global companies. Innovation: We are at the intersection of finance and technology, shaping the future with bold ideas every day. We are looking for an experienced Frontend Engineer to help us build modern, high-quality, and reliable web applications using React, Next.js, and our internal design system and tooling. In this role, you will be responsible for developing user-facing applications, shared component libraries, and platform solutions that are utilized across multiple products within the company. You will collaborate closely with design, backend, and platform teams, with a strong focus on performance, accessibility, and stability. Tech Stack: Frontend: TypeScript, React 18/19, Next.js, Redux Toolkit, RTK Query, React Router, Salmon-UI (MUI-based design system), Emotion, Storybook, Theming & Localization Build & Environment: Webpack, Vite, Husky, Semantic Release, Swagger TypeScript API (API typings generation) Testing: React Testing Library, Jest, Cypress / Playwright Monitoring & Analytics: Sentry, Prometheus, Grafana CI/CD & Code Quality: GitLab CI, ESLint, Prettier, Stylelint, Webpack Bundle Analyzer Design: Figma, Pixel-perfect implementation, Component-driven development with Storybook Responsibilities: Develop and maintain user interfaces using React and Next.js. Work with our design system, theming, and localization to create consistent and responsive interfaces. Build reusable UI components and contribute to the shared component library. Integrate with REST and GraphQL APIs using generated typings. Optimize rendering performance and bundle size for improved user experience. Write and maintain unit and integration tests to ensure product reliability. Participate in code reviews and contribute to evolving frontend best practices. Work with error monitoring, logging, and analytics tools to ensure system health. Collaborate closely with designers and backend engineers to deliver seamless user experiences. Participate in architectural discussions and contribute to technical solution design. We’re Looking for Someone Who: Has strong experience with React and TypeScript. Understands Next.js fundamentals (routing, SSR, ISR, data fetching). Is proficient in modern state management using Redux Toolkit and RTK Query. Has experience with component-driven development and design system principles. Is familiar with build tools (Webpack, Vite) and CI/CD fundamentals. Pays close attention to UX, accessibility, and visual details. Writes comprehensive tests and values product reliability. Has a solid understanding of web performance fundamentals and optimizing web applications. Nice-to-Haves: Experience with Node.js / NestJS. Understanding of system design basics (API design, caching, scalability). Experience with Headless CMS (Strapi or similar). Experience with analytics and A/B testing. Participation in building design systems or UI libraries. Expertise in performance optimization or bundle analysis. Experience working in constrained or non-standard environments (kiosks, embedded systems, terminals). Why You Should Join Us: Collaborative and dynamic environment: Work with passionate, talented teams across design, backend, and platform. Innovation-driven culture: Your contributions will directly impact the way millions of Filipinos experience banking. Professional growth: We offer opportunities for rapid professional development, recognizing and rewarding merit. Remote and hybrid options: Flexibility in your work environment. Comprehensive benefits: Medical insurance, health and wellness benefits, and much more. If you're excited about working on cutting-edge fintech solutions, contributing to the development of a world-class design system, and being part of a rapidly growing company – this is the role for you. Apply now and help us build the future of banking!

More open positions

Ecommerce Growth & Conversion Manager (DTC, Amazon, TikTok Shop)

Work from home Full-time role

Transaction Antifraud Engineer

Work from home Full-time role

Senior Solutions Consultant

Work from home Full-time role

AQA Engineer - ATM Stream

Work from home Full-time role

Brand Marketing & Partnerships Manager

Work from home Full-time role

Help Desk Support - Part Time Weekend Shift - Remote

Work from home Full-time role

Vice President, Legal, Corporate Governance, Securities, M & A

Work from home Full-time role

Insurance Sales Account Representative

Work from home Full-time role

[Remote] Technical Project Manager, Agile/Scrum

Work from home Full-time role

AI Solutions Architect

Work from home Full-time role

Alpheratz Project - Danish (Denmark) Translation Quality Rater

Work from home Full-time role

Blockchain Developer, Work from Home

Work from home Full-time role

.NET Full Stack Developer

Work from home Full-time role

Dynamic Live Chat Representative – Customer Engagement & Lead Qualification Specialist for careerzynith

Work from home Full-time role

Onboarding Specialist - SMB - Remote

Work from home Full-time role

Senior AEO Growth Marketer

Work from home Full-time role

Events Marketing Manager, EMEA/META

Work from home Full-time role

Entry-Level Remote Data Entry Clerk – Accurate Digital Records Management & Customer Order Support

Work from home Full-time role

Remote Chat Support Specialist – Entry-Level Online Customer Experience Agent | Competitive $25–$35/hr | Flexible Hours

Work from home Full-time role

Information Security Analyst - Remote

Work from home Full-time role

Interior Designer | Hospitality Design (Remote ...

Work from home Full-time role